Witryna18 lut 2024 · Stretching over 50 kilometres long, Loch Linnhe is a large sea loch in the west coast of Scotland. Following the line of the Great Glen Fault, it forges a path inland, eventually striking the heart of the highlands. The northeast end of the loch lies just south of the town of Fort William and the loch itself is known for its beautiful scenery. WitrynaA large sea loch in west central Scotland, Loch Linnhe separates the Morvern and Ardgour peninsulas to the west from the districts of Appin and Benderloch and parts of Lochaber to the east. The … WitrynaResults from an observational study of the internal tide of Upper Loch Linnhe, a fjord on the west coast of Scotland, are presented. Between November 1992 and June 1993, moorings containing current meters measuring velocity, temperature and salinity were deployed at two sites in the loch. Witryna5 wrz 2024 · Daily river flow data were downloaded from the National River Flow Archive for the rivers Lochy and Nevis (NRFA, 2016), which flow into the northern end of the Upper Loch. The data covered our observation periods in 2011 and 2012, and 1980–2012 data were used to calculate a long-term freshwater inflow average.
